Patrick Darling, a 32-year-old musician diagnosed with ALS at 29, experienced the emotional power of AI when it allowed him to sing again on stage after losing his voice to the disease, according to MIT Technology Review. His last stage performance was over two years prior to this event. The technology enabled him to perform again with his bandmates.

"Off Grid," a new application, offers a "Swiss Army Knife" of offline AI tools, including text generation, image generation, vision AI, voice transcription, and document analysis, all running natively on a mobile device, as reported by Hacker News. This app supports various language models and allows users to generate images offline.
However, the technology is also being used for malicious purposes. Vox reported that romance scams, which are at an all-time high, cost Americans $3 billion last year. These scams often involve fraudsters building relationships with victims to gain their trust and money.
